When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Minera?
Good weather’s always better when you want to venture out and explore, so here are some stats about the local climate: The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Minera is 842 mm.
What is there to see and do in Minera?
Get out into nature with places such as Clwydian Range And Dee Valley, Gower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ty and Minera Lead Mines and Country Park. Cultural attractions include William Aston Hall Wrexham, Theatr Clwyd and Grosvenor Museum. Locals like to shop at The Rows of Chester.
